Messier 20, or the Trifid nebula, in the constellation Sagittarius.

This object is an unusual combination of an open cluster of stars, an emission nebula and a reflection nebula.

 

Canon EOS 60D Ha Modified @ ISO 1600.

100x30 sec subs with calibration frames added.

Celestron C11 at f6.3.

Tracked on a Skywatcher AZ-EQ6 mount with no guiding.

Polar aligned : Polar Scope.

Acquisition : Intervalometer.

Imaged from suburbia.

Processed in APP and finished off in LR.
